Girls Who Code
For grades 3-5
Girls Who Code is a national non-profit working to close the gender gap in technology. Together they will learn the concepts of loops, variables, conditionals and functions that form the basis for all programming languages and work in teams to design a computer science impact project that solves real world problems. JPL will be be hosting this FREE after-school program for girls in grades 3-5 to join our sisterhood of supportive peers and role models and use computer science to change the world.
